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

Exploitation de données avec modèle en étoile

Bonjour,

Pour un état QV, j'ai besoin d'utiliser un modèle en étoile.

Je n'arrive pas à comprendre comment exploiter les données de ce schéma .

J'ai essayé avec les "set analysis", mais sans succès...

Auriez-vous une piste ?

Merci.

9 Replies
rfe
Employee
Employee

Bonjour,

Le chargement d'un modèle en étoile ne pose normalement aucun problème. Pouvez vous faire une copie d'écran de vos tables chargées dans QV ainsi que vos problèmes rencontrés afin de vous aider ?

Not applicable
Author

Je suis d'accord avec vous, aucun souci pour le chargement.

Je parle ici, d'exploitation des données.

Comment faire des jointures ?

Comment utiliser les expressions ?

Ou plus simplement, comment utiliser ces données ?

armandfrigo
Partner Ambassador
Partner Ambassador

Bonjour,

Les jointures se font par homonymie de champs.

Exemple : vous avez un champ CustomerID dans votre table Client et le même dans votre table de faits, QlikView va automatiquement créer le lien entre ces deux tables.

Pour renommer un champ, vous pouvez le faire dans l'assistant d'import de données en cliquant sur l'entête de colonne ou bien vous pouvez utiliser l'instruction "as".

Exemple : Load... Identifiant as CustomerID, ...

Une fois que votre modèle sera créé, vous n'avez rien de plus à faire pour l'utiliser, avec l'associativité vos données seront déjà toutes liées entre elles. Pour ainsi dire, vous pourrez ensuite ajouter des listes et des graphiques pour constituer l'interface visuelle de votre tableau de bord.

Il y a quelques vidéos qui montrent cela en français : http://www.qlik.com/fr/landing/fr-premiers-pas-avec-qlikview.aspx#

Not applicable
Author

Merci pour la réponse.

J'utilise déjà QlikView depuis près d'un an.

Ma question se porte sur le modèle en étoile...

J'ai de grosses différences d'affichage entre un modèle dit "relationnel" et un modèle en étoile (dans les tableaux croisés par exemple). Mes données affichées ne sont pas les mêmes selon le modèle.

Et je ne comprend pas comment résoudre ces soucis.

armandfrigo
Partner Ambassador
Partner Ambassador

En principe, cela ne doit pas faire de différence.

Vous avez un exemple pour comparer les deux situations dans QlikView?

martin59
Specialist II
Specialist II

Bonjour,

Vous trouverez sur le site d'Yves Ducourneau un ensemble d'articles très intéressants sur la logique de QlikView et principalement autour du modèle en étoile. Je vous invite à le consulter pour mieux appréhender la constructions de modèles sous QlikView.

Voici l'URL : http://yves.ducourneau.perso.sfr.fr/qlikview-modelisation-etoile.html

Martin Favier

martin59
Specialist II
Specialist II

Bonjour,

Le problème est-il toujours d'actualité ou il a été résolu ?

Martin Favier

Not applicable
Author

Le problème est résolu en partie.

Mon problème était au niveau des clés et la schématisation de celles-ci dans la table de fait.

Merci à tous.

Not applicable
Author

on faire des jointures autrement que par homonymie de champs ? Je m'explique, j'ai une double jointure à faire entre deux tables. De cette façon ci :

SteffieLili_cim10.png

Sous Qlikview, si je renomme les champs DP et DR en Cim10id pour faire la jointure, cela me donnera deux attributs avec les mêmes noms et je ne suis pas sure que cela puisse marcher.

Quelle solution pourrais-je avoir ?